Senior Electrical Substation Project Engineer responsible for HV/EHV substation design at GE Vernova. Focus on project coordination, technical leadership, and comprehensive engineering deliverables.
Responsibilities
manage and own project HV/EHV substation engineering activities, ensuring consistent functional specifications and standardized processes across all project implementations
focus on understanding and meeting customer expectations through effective planning and flawless execution
responsible for the full scope of HV/EHV substation design, serving as a technical leader across engineering projects
lead and coordinate all technical aspects of AC power substation projects
serve as the primary technical lead, responsible for scheduling, compliance to standards and specifications, value engineering, design review planning, engineering hours budget, and ensuring quality assurance and control
develop and oversee key design deliverables, including: Power single-line diagrams, General substation arrangement drawings (plan & substation layout, elevation, grounding, conduit/trench, cable routing, detail drawings and control buildings layouts), High-voltage bus, structures, equipment, and wiring arrangements
act as the single point of contact for all technical matters between customers, vendors, project managers, and engineering teams
accountable for directing and supporting engineers and designers to meet technical specifications, budget constraints, and project timelines
drive cross-discipline coordination to deliver fully integrated substation solutions
review and contribute to ITO (Inquiry-to-Order) process deliverables, including: Conceptual engineering, Proposal documentation (e.g., BOMs, technical specifications), Sourcing support, vendor quotation evaluation, and technical clarifications & assumptions
lead preparation of high-voltage equipment specifications and contractor work scopes; support vendor engagement and equipment selection.
assist the manager in ensuring team productivity and billable utilization
ensure all engineering outputs meet customer CTQs (Critical to Quality), and are delivered on time and within budget
support commissioning and interface efforts between customers and project stakeholders
Requirements
Bachelor's Degree in Engineering from an accredited university
Minimum of 10 years of experience in industrial or utility HV/EHV substation design, or a Master’s Degree in Electrical Engineering with +7 years of relevant experience
Ability and willingness to travel up to 20% (including international), in compliance with company travel and tax policies
Licensed Professional Engineer (P.E.) in the U.S. in good standing with ability to get licensure in other states. Willingness to use license.
Experience with PG&E substation design standards
Proven expertise in: Transmission & Distribution substation engineering (utility and renewable energy), Primary (outdoor) substation design, calculations, and electrical protection, Industrial power system design (12.5 kV and above)
Proficient in key design calculations including: Battery sizing, DC system design and AC auxiliary power, Power transformer and circuit breaker selection, Conductor sizing and application, Grounding, lightning protection, and insulation coordination
Knowledge of IEEE, ANSI, NEC, and NESC standards; able to develop complete engineering packages in the absence of detailed customer specifications
Field-testing and commissioning experience, with strong emphasis on safety
Strong troubleshooting skills—both electrical and mechanical
Excellent customer-facing communication and commercial awareness (e.g., change orders, project delivery)
Proficiency in AutoCAD/MicroStation and design automation tools
